On 4/19/06, Stanley Robins < [E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
i am sending emails to lists and sometimes when the emails bounce they clog my inbox so i have configured that account to delete all the emails from qmailadmin and those rules have created since 4 hours but still i get all the emails in the inbox how can i delete them ??? is some other config to be done ? i tried lwq but didnt find my answer in that...

pls help i am getting more than 20000 bounces :(



In QMailAdmin, did you select a default catchall account? The bounces will go there. If you set it to delete the bounces, then what you're probably getting are double bounces. The server will try and send an error message back to the user letting them know the message bounced, and since it's a bad email address they bounce back to your server. They bounced twice, so they're a double bounce. That would be my first guess. Otherwise, send the header info of one of the bounced messages so we can see what's going on.
